Unfilled grade for automotive on-line painted components. Dimensional stability. Excellent chemical resistance. Class A surface appearance.

PhysicalNominal ValueUnitTest Method
Specific Gravity ASTM D792
    -- 1.10g/cm³ASTM D792
    -- 1.11g/cm³ASTM D792
Molding Shrinkage
    Flow : 130°C, 1 hour 1.6 - 1.8%ASTM D955
    Flow : 3.20mm 1.1 - 1.3%Internal method
    Transverse flow : 3.20mm 1.0 - 1.2%Internal method
Water Absorption ASTM D570
    24 hr, 50% RH 0.50%ASTM D570
    Balance, 50% RH 1.0%ASTM D570
HardnessNominal ValueUnitTest Method
Rockwell Hardness (R-Scale)116ASTM D785
MechanicalNominal ValueUnitTest Method
Tensile Strength 1ASTM D638
    Yield 59.3MPaASTM D638
    Fracture 55.2MPaASTM D638
Tensile Elongation 2(Break)60%ASTM D638
Flexural Modulus 3(100 mm Span)2250MPaASTM D790
Flexural Strength 4(Yield, 100 mm Span)95.8MPaASTM D790
ImpactNominal ValueUnitTest Method
Notched Izod Impact ASTM D256
    -30°C 130J/mASTM D256
    23°C 240J/mASTM D256
Instrumented Dart Impact ASTM D3763
    -30°C, Energy at Peak Load 39.5JASTM D3763
    23°C, Energy at Peak Load 50.8JASTM D3763
ThermalNominal ValueUnitTest Method
Deflection Temperature Under Load ASTM D648
    0.45 MPa, unannealed, 6.40mm 193°CASTM D648
    1.8 MPa, unannealed, 6.40mm 143°CASTM D648
Vicat Softening Temperature 232°CASTM D1525 5
Linear thermal expansion coefficient ASTM E831
    Flow : -40 to 95°C 9.0E-5cm/cm/°CASTM E831
    Flow : 60 to 138°C 1.3E-4cm/cm/°CASTM E831
    Lateral : -40 to 95°C 9.0E-5cm/cm/°CASTM E831
    Horizontal : 60 to 138°C 1.3E-4cm/cm/°CASTM E831
RTI Elec 50.0°CUL 746
RTI Imp 50.0°CUL 746
RTI 50.0°CUL 746
ElectricalNominal ValueTest Method
Arc Resistance 6PLC 7ASTM D495
Comparative Tracking Index (CTI) PLC 1UL 746
High Amp Arc Ignition (HAI) PLC 0UL 746
High Voltage Arc Tracking Rate (HVTR) PLC 4UL 746
Hot-wire Ignition (HWI) PLC 3UL 746
FlammabilityNominal ValueTest Method
Flame Rating (1.50 mm)HBUL 94
InjectionNominal ValueUnit
Drying Temperature 93.3 - 107°C
Drying Time 3.0 - 4.0hr
Drying Time, Maximum 8.0hr
Suggested Max Moisture 0.070%
Suggested Shot Size 30 - 50%
Rear Temperature 266 - 304°C
Middle Temperature 271 - 304°C
Front Temperature 277 - 304°C
Nozzle Temperature 282 - 304°C
Processing (Melt) Temp 282 - 304°C
Mold Temperature 76.7 - 121°C
Back Pressure 0.345 - 1.38MPa
Screw Speed 20 - 100rpm
Vent Depth 0.013 - 0.038mm
